Precision Ag Partnerships More Than Doubled in 2025. What Changed — and What It Points To.

The number of precision agriculture partnerships tracked by iGrow Intelligence rose from 21 in 2024 to 61 in 2025 — a 190% increase.

Textron Aviation Secures USDA Order for Three Cessna Caravans to Support Pest Management

Textron Aviation has announced that the USDA Animal and Plant Health Inspection Service (APHIS) has ordered three Cessna Caravan aircraft to support its sterile insect release programme along the Rio Grande River in southern Texas.

U.S. Sugar Launches Largest Commercial Autonomous Tractor Fleet in American Sugar Industry

U.S. Sugar has announced the launch of the largest commercial deployment of autonomous tractors in the American sugar industry, operating a fleet of five unmanned John Deere tractors across its 255,000-acre farming operation in South Florida.

China Leads Precision Ag Patent Filings by a Wide Margin. The Grant Rate Tells a Different Story

China filed 66,095 precision agriculture patents in 2024, accounting for 63% of all global filings — but only 247 were granted, a 0.4% conversion rate.

John Deere Made Two Precision Ag Acquisitions in Three Months

John Deere acquired Sentera in May 2025 and GUSS Automation in August 2025, adding aerial imagery and autonomous spray capability respectively.
